What Causes Ear Numbness After Facelift Surgery?
Ear numbness after facelift can occur because sensory nerves around the ear may be affected during surgery.
Temporary Nerve Stretching During Surgery
During facelift surgery, tissues around the ear are lifted and repositioned.
Small sensory nerves may experience:
- Stretching
- Temporary irritation
- Compression
- Reduced nerve signaling
This can result in temporary numbness or altered sensation.
Swelling and Inflammation
Postoperative swelling can affect nearby nerves.
Swelling may cause:
- Reduced sensation
- Tingling feelings
- Burning sensations
- Increased sensitivity
As inflammation decreases, nerve function often gradually improves.
Scar Tissue Formation
Scar tissue develops naturally after facelift surgery.
In some cases, internal scar formation may place pressure on nearby nerves and contribute to:
- Persistent numbness
- Tight sensations
- Unusual skin sensitivity
- Tingling around the ear
Sensory Nerve Irritation or Injury
Small sensory nerves near the ear may be affected during incision or tissue repositioning.
Possible symptoms include:
- Reduced feeling
- Numb patches
- Altered temperature sensation
- Tingling or sensitivity changes
Most sensory nerve problems improve over time, but evaluation may be needed if symptoms persist.

Is Ear Numbness Normal After Facelift?
Yes, temporary numbness is considered a common part of facelift recovery.
First Few Weeks After Surgery
Patients may experience:
- Numbness
- Tingling
- Tightness
- Reduced sensation
These symptoms occur because nerves need time to recover.
Several Months After Surgery
Sensation usually improves gradually as nerve fibers regenerate.
Patients may notice:
- Return of feeling
- Reduced tingling
- Improved sensitivity
After One Year
Persistent numbness after a long recovery period may require evaluation by an experienced facelift specialist.
How Long Does Ear Numbness Last After Facelift?
Recovery time varies between patients.
Factors affecting nerve recovery include:
- Surgical technique
- Individual nerve healing ability
- Degree of nerve irritation
- Scar formation
- Previous facial procedures
Some patients notice improvement within months, while others may experience slower recovery.

FAQs
Why is my ear numb after facelift surgery?
Ear numbness may occur because sensory nerves around the ear are temporarily affected during surgery or healing.
How long does ear numbness last after facelift?
Recovery varies, but many patients notice gradual improvement over several months.
Is ear numbness permanent after facelift?
Most cases improve over time, but persistent symptoms should be evaluated by a specialist.
Can scar tissue cause ear numbness after facelift?
Yes. Scar tissue may place pressure on nearby nerves and contribute to altered sensation.
When should I worry about ear numbness after facelift?
Patients should seek evaluation if numbness persists, worsens, or is associated with pain or weakness.
Can nerve damage after facelift be treated?
Treatment depends on the cause and may include monitoring, supportive care, scar management, or revision procedures.
